  • Title

    A single chip CMOS transceiver for 802.11 a/b/g WLANs

  • Abstract
    A 0.18 μm dual-band tri-mode CMOS radio, fully compliant with the IEEE 802.11 a/b/g standards, achieves a system noise figure of 5.2/5.6 dB (high gain), and an EVM of 2.7/3.0% for the 2.4/5 GHz bands, respectively. Die area is 12 mm2, and power consumption is 200 mW in RX and 240 mW in TX using a 1.8 V supply.
